HOUSTONLeaving George Bush Intercontinental: transport guide
Far from downtown and limited transit. Rideshare is the default; taxis use flat zones.
IAH (George Bush Intercontinental) serves Houston, United States. The recommended way out is Uber/Lyft from the designated lots (~$35–$55 to downtown, 30–50 min). Pickup: Terminal-specific rideshare lots.

From gate to city
- 1Clear baggage and follow rideshare signs
- 2Each terminal has a dedicated rideshare lot
- 3Taxi rank at curbside — flat zones posted
- 4METRO 102 Express bus to downtown ($4.50)
- 5Plan 30–60 min to downtown
- Rideshare from designated lot
- Flat zone to downtown $55
- Ignore curbside touts
Common scams & payment traps
- Taxis accept cards by ordinance
- METRO Q card or cash exact change on bus
Curbside 'limo'
Medium riskDriver offers a $100 flat-rate to downtown.
HOW TO AVOID · Use rideshare or the official taxi zone.
Off-meter / off-zone fare
Medium riskTaxi ignores the flat-zone rate and demands more.
HOW TO AVOID · Insist on the posted zone fare or get out.

IAH arrival FAQs
- What is the safest way to leave George Bush Intercontinental?
- Uber/Lyft from the designated lots. Ignore curbside 'private car' offers.
- Are taxis at IAH safe?
- Official taxis from the marked rank are generally fine, but watch for: curbside 'limo' — Driver offers a $100 flat-rate to downtown. Use rideshare or the official taxi zone.
- Is ride-hailing (Uber, Bolt, Grab or similar) available at IAH?
- Yes — Uber / Lyft works at IAH. Typical cost $35–$55, journey ~30–50 min. Use the in-app pickup point rather than the arrivals curb.
- How much should a taxi from IAH to the city centre cost?
- Expected fare on the IAH → Downtown Houston route is roughly $4.50–$55. Anything around $80+ is high — $100+ unmarked car is a scam. Fares vary with traffic, time of day and taxi type, so confirm before you get in.
- Do I need cash for a taxi at IAH?
- Carry small local notes — Taxi (flat zone) expects card & cash. A backup card with no FX fees helps if a driver claims the terminal is broken.
- Where is the official taxi pickup at George Bush Intercontinental?
- Terminal-specific rideshare lots. If you can't see a marked rank with a dispatcher or queue, walk back inside and ask at the information desk — never take an offer from someone roaming arrivals.
- Is IAH safe to arrive at late at night?
- IAH is generally manageable at night if you stick to the official taxi rank or pre-book a transfer. Avoid empty bus stops and outdoor pickup zones, and confirm your ride is moving before sharing personal details.
